Justice for Your Loved One Requires a Skilled Wrongful Death Lawyer in Manchester, NH

Wrongful death claims are used to pursue financial compensation from the party responsible for the victim’s death. The victim’s estate can recover for pain and suffering, medical bills, lost wages, and other damages. A surviving spouse, parent, or child can recover for their loss of companionship and family ties, up to a certain dollar amount set by statute. Wrongful death claims apply to negligent and intentional misconduct.

We Act Immediately to Preserve Evidence of Liability

Much of the evidence needed to support a wrongful death case can be lost in the days and weeks after an accident. Witnesses must be located and interviewed. Physical evidence must be collected and preserved. Police reports, hospital records, employment files, maintenance logs – any one of these items could later prove to be the key to a substantial damage award.

Expert Witnesses

An attorney handling a wrongful death claim should have experience with the type of negligent conduct that occurred in the case. A truck accidents lawyer, for example, would be well-suited to handle a claim stemming from a fatal collision with a tractor trailer. The same principle holds true for expert witnesses. At Kenison Law Office, our wrongful death attorneys maintain a network of specialists who can advise on the technical and economic issues that appear in these cases, such as:

  • Accident reconstruction
  • Mechanical failures
  • Safety regulations, protocols, and best practices
  • Professional standards of care
  • Medical expenses and lost wages
  • Loss of future earning capacity

Selecting the right expert witness is important because catastrophic accidents can be highly complex. We spent years building relationships to ensure the right industry expert is available to our firm when the need arises.
